Sitting off from the main street in the heart of Windermere, is this beautifully appointed, stone cottage. Giddy Goose offers a wonderful position for exploring the Lake District with the family or a group of friends, boasting a well-presented interior and amenities on the doorstep. On entrance is a vestibule, where you can kick of your boots and hang your coats before relaxing away your evening inside. On the right is a cosy lounge boasting a large bay window and character oozing from the walls. Not only does the coal-effect fire add warmth to the sitting room, the colour schemes uplift your mood each day. The fully fitted kitchen overlooks the patio area and the dining room displays a large dining table set for eight. Over the first and second floors are the bedrooms giving you flexible sleeping arrangements. There is a cloakroom on both levels with the addition of a gleaming family bathroom and an en-suite adjoining the master bedroom. Access to the parking area is via a private lane and the enclosed garden wraps itself around the exterior, with a sunny patio area and bistro set for enjoying a refreshing beverage. Plant pots line the edge with colourful shrubs and over the wall are views of the quiet, public fields to the rear. Windermere is a thriving town, with many attractions for all ages to enjoy. Why not browse the shops before a delicious pub lunch? Or take a boat cruise to Bowness and venture on one of many countryside walks? There is mountain biking at Grizedale and the kids will love the 'World of Beatrix Potter'. Those seeking a thrill can fly through the air on a zip wire, climb tree tops and take part in an adventure like no other at Go Ape adventure park! You are also surrounded by many pretty towns and villages, well worth a visit; so consider a stay at Giddy Goose.
